What is AML in Banking?

by Cheqly team | | AML , Banking

The purpose of anti-money laundering (AML) regulations is to prevent criminals from smuggling illegal money into the financial system. The purpose of money laundering schemes is to hide the ownership and source of funds acquired through illicit activities like drug trafficking and terrorism.
